I'm using a pair of orinoco silver cards. One in a PCI bridge card in a desktop machine, the other in my laptop. Both are running recent Stable release Both cards report fine via wicontrol and with the recent release ifconfig even gives interesting information about the cards. Still I cannot get them to talk together. Both cards are configured as shown below, except the laptop has Create IBSS set to 0. NIC serial number: [ 01UT17362526 ] Station name: [ fedde ] SSID for IBSS creation: [ Fedde ] Current netname (SSID): [ Fedde ] Desired netname (SSID): [ Fedde ] Current BSSID: [ 02:02:2d:29:22:52 ] Channel list: [ 2047 ] IBSS channel: [ 10 ] Current channel: [ 10 ] Comms quality/signal/noise: [ 0 27 27 ] Promiscuous mode: [ Off ] Port type (1=BSS, 3=ad-hoc): [ 1 ] MAC address: [ 00:02:2d:29:22:52 ] TX rate (selection): [ 3 ] TX rate (actual speed): [ 2 ] RTS/CTS handshake threshold: [ 2347 ] Create IBSS: [ On ] Access point density: [ 1 ] Power Mgmt (1=on, 0=off): [ 0 ] Max sleep time: [ 0 ] WEP encryption: [ On ] TX encryption key: [ 1 ] Encryption keys: [ ][ ][ ][ ] I've taken both cards to the office where we have a macintosh airport based system and I link up just fine there.
